Record-breaking wicketkeeper-batsman Mushfiqur Rahim hit an unbeaten 219 as Bangladesh declared their first innings on 522 runs for the loss of seven wickets in 160 overson day two of their second and final Test match against Zimbabwe at Mirpur Sher-e-Bangla National Cricket Stadium in Dhaka Monday.

Alongside Mushfiq, youngster Mehedi Hasan Miraz was unbeaten on 68.

2ND TEST, DAY 2
BANGLADESH 1ST INNINGS R B
Liton c Mavuta b Jarvis 9 35
Imrul c Chakabva b Jarvis 0 16
Mominul c Chari b Chatara 161 247
Mithun c Taylor b Jarvis 0 4
Mushfiq not out 219 421
Taijul c Chakabva b Jarvis 4 10
Mahmudullah c Chakabva b Jarvis 36 110
Ariful c Chari b Jarvis 4 18
Miraz not out 68 102
Extras (b 9, lb 8, nb 3, w 1) 21
Total (160 Overs) 522/7d
Fall Of Wickets
1-13 (Imrul), 2-16 (Liton), 3-26 (Mithun), 4-292 (Mominul), 5-299 (Taijul), 6-372 (Mahmudullah), 7-378 (Ariful)
Bowling
Jarvis 28-6-71-5, Chatara 22.2-12-34-1, Tiripano 24.4-6-65-1, Raza 22-1-111-0, Williams 30-4-80-0, Mavuta 31-1-137-0, Masakadza 2-0-7-0
ZIMBABWE 1ST INNINGS R B
Masakadza c Miraz b Taijul 14 44
Chari not out 10 48
Tiripano not out 0 16
Extras (b 1) 1
Total (18 Overs) 25/1
Fall Of Wickets
1-20 (Masakadza)
Bowling
Mustafizur 6-4-11-0, Khaled 5-3-6-0, Taijul 5-3-5-1, Miraz 2-1-2-0
Zimbabwe trail by 497 runs
